Output 99e3038d1619ec1b6aa3421f60426f87d8f79127a786be6a32cfebee5119ec5a:0

value
2089045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c8739c6f68e4879a94548a8bc288b217f0f7be OP_EQUAL
address
3PBirFCaeXeErwTcqMhjAWayTBEBhd6aLy
transaction
99e3038d1619ec1b6aa3421f60426f87d8f79127a786be6a32cfebee5119ec5a
confirmations
275326
spent
true